Neal Ardley said that he is aiming to complete his summer recruitment by bringing in another forward.
Following the addition of midfielder Liam Trotter, Neal is aiming to bolster his attacking options, but he is prepared to be patient in search of the right player.
"Now we have to do a little bit of work to complete the final piece of the jigsaw," said Neal. "We have to do a little bit of work before we can raise the money to bring in a forward. We will be a bit more patient with the forward. I think things will need to happen for us to move on that one. Money is a bit tighter after bringing in Jimmy and Liam. We will try and get the right player in who will help us through the season."
The Dons have so far brought in seven new players with Deji Oshjilaja, Cody McDonald, George Long, Callum Kennedy, Kwesi Appiah, Jimmy Abdou and Liam Trotter, having all signed on the dotted line.
